Output 80bd958693501decbec89a5a222ac86f0bc1ddf848b82ab02f9a225bb4bba863:1

value
144509056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d98c34d24270db8504fe34f95e002fa00c795c6c OP_EQUAL
address
3MXJWss6Pyncbq5G6LJxZkFvG8Gm2jSqtA
transaction
80bd958693501decbec89a5a222ac86f0bc1ddf848b82ab02f9a225bb4bba863